Scarlett Johansson Is Regal in a Baby Pink Gown Covered in Crimson Jewels

When Scarlett Johansson enters a room, it’s difficult to look anywhere else—and that is especially true if the actor is shimmering like a couture disco ball in a sequin-covered gown.

That was the case this Wednesday, when ScarJo and co-star Channing Tatum arrived at Zoo Palast in Berlin for the German premiere of their film Fly Me to the Moon.

The Her star appeared in a baby pink midi dress entirely covered in sequins and featuring large crimson jewels dancing along the neckline and waist, as well as on the thick black shoulder straps. Smaller blood-red stones adorned the skirt in the shape of abstract constellations, and a few more lined the hem and high leg slit.

Johansson wore the dress layered over a bright red slip which peeked out like a bra at the bust and went down past the dress, to her ankles. she finished the maximalist look with a pair of strappy black heels to match the straps of her midi, and a cherry red lip.

On the carpet, Johansson posed for photos with Tatum, who looked cool in a concrete-gray suit, black dress shirt, and black shoes.

The two have been busy promoting their new romantic comedy this week. Directed by Greg Berlanti, the movie follows the story of a relationship that develops between the NASA director in charge of the Apollo 11 launch and the marketing specialist brought in to fix the agency’s image during the Space Race of the 1960s. Per IMDb: “Marketing maven Kelly Jones wreaks havoc on launch director Cole Davis’s already difficult task. When the White House deems the mission too important to fail, Jones is directed to stage a fake moon landing as backup.” It comes out in theaters on July 12.
